数据库复习资料4_第1页
数据库复习资料4_第2页
数据库复习资料4_第3页
数据库复习资料4_第4页
数据库复习资料4_第5页
已阅读5页,还剩2页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

1、综合练习四单项选择题1、在关系模式R(U”屮,如果X-Y,存在X的其子集X,使X-Y,称曲数依赖X-*Y 为(九A、平凡函数依赖B、部分函数依赖C、完全函数依赖D、传递函数依赖2、在关系模式R (UT)中.如果X-U,则X是R的()oA、候选键 E、主键 C、超键 D.外琏3、在关系模式R (UJO中,如果F是最小两数依赖集,则()。A、至少有RG2NF,B、至少有RG3NF,C、至少有RGBCNF,D、R的规范化程度与F是否最小甫数依赖集无关4、在关系模式R(UT)屮,如來X-Y,如果不存在X的其了集X】,使Xi-*Y称函数依赖X -Y为()oA. 平凡函数依赖B.部分函数依赖C、完全函数依

2、赖D、传递函数依赖5、在关系模式中,R中任何非主属性对键完全函数依赖是RW3NF的()A. 允分必要条件B.必要条件C、分条件D.既不充分也不必要条件6、对关系模式进行分解时,要求保持两数依赖,最髙可以达到()。A、NFB. 3NFC、BCNFD、4NF7、在关系模式RCUJ5)中,对任何非平凡的函数依赖X-Y, X均包含键,则R最高可以达 到()。A、2NFB、3NFC、BCNFD、4NF8 .每个XA1 (1 =1,2,口 )成立是XA Az>An成立的()。A、充分必要条件E、必耍乘件C.允分条件D、既不允分也不必耍条件9. 对关系模式进行分解时,耍使分解貝冇无损欠连接性,在卜属范

3、式中最高可以达到()。A、NFB、3NFC、BCNFD. 4NF10. 在二尤关系模式川I, X、Y都足单-屈性,如果X-Y,则R最高可以达到().A、2NFB. 3NFC、BCNFD、4NF11. 关系模式0U占力如呆RW2NE 基本可以消除的数抓异常足()oA、插入异常B.删除异常 C.候选键兀余 D、数据兀余过人12. 在关系模式R(UT丿中,YGXF4是X-Y是否成立的()。A、允分必耍条件B、必耍条件C、充分条件D、既不充分也不必耍条件13. 在关系模式R(UT丿X、Y. Z都是属性,HY-Y>则 W则X-Z是()A. 一定是传递函数依赖B、一定不是传递函数依赖C、不一定是传递

4、换数依赖 D、如果X是单一属性.则是传递西数依赖14. 在二元关系模式R(UF)屮,则R最高可以达到()。A、NFB、3NFC. BCNFD> 4NF15. 在关系模式屮,“每个主属性对不包含它的键完全函数依赖”,是RW3NF的()。A、允分必耍条件B.必要条件C.允分条件D、既不充分也不必要条件16対关系模式进行分解时,要使分解既保持函数依赖、又具冇无损失连接性,在卜屈范式 中加高可以达到()。A、NFB、3NFC、BCNFD、4NF17、在关系模式玖UT丿屮,RC3NF HJLW一的候选健,则()。A、R 属 J: 3NF 不屈于 BCNFE、R 一定属 F BCNFC. R不一定属

5、J; BCNFD.当候选键是单属性时.R属BCNF18. 卜列关J函数依赖与多值依赖叙述屮,1E确的是()。A、当XY时,X的每个值一定对应Y的多个值B、当Y时X的子集时,称为平凡多值依赖C、换数依赖是多值依赖的特例.多值依赖是怖数依赖的推广D、女值依赖是函数依赖的特例,函数依赖是多值依赖的推广19. 在关系模式出UT川X F是最小函数依赖集,属性T只在F中诸隨数依赖“一” 的左端出现,则属性T具何如卜性质()oA、属性T仅是R的主属性B、圏性T必是R的非主属性C、属性T必是组成R任何候选键的主属性D、属性T可能是R的主属性.也可能是R的非主属性20. 在下列叙述中,正确的是()A、对J:关系

6、数模熨.规范化程度越高越好B、如果F是最小函数依赖集,则RG2NFC、如果则RGBCNF,则F是授小函数依赖集D、关系模式分解为BCNF后函数依赖关系可能被破坏21. 在关系模式R(U中.F是最小换数依赖集,属性T只在F中诸两数依赖 的右端出现,则属性T Mi如下性质()。A、属性T仅是R的主属性B、厲性T必是R的非主属性C、属性T必是组成R任何候选键的主属性D、厲性T可能是R的主属性,也可能是R的非主属性22. 在关系模式R(UT丿中,如果任何非主属性对候选键完全函数依赖,则()A、RE2NFBx RG3NFC、RG4NF D、RGBCNF23. 关系数据规范化耍解决的问题是:插入异常、删除

7、异常和().A.数据冗余E、保障数据安全性6査询复杂D、控制数据完整性24. 在关系数据模式中,任何二元模式垠高町以达到的模式是()oA、4NF B. 2NF C、3NFD、BCNF25、由全码组成的关系模式.址高可以达到的模式是()。A、4NF B. 2NF C、3NFD、BCNF26. 在关系数据模式中.所右属性都是主属性的模式最高可以达到()Ax 4NFC> 3NFD、BCNF27、在关系模式的分解中保持函数依赖分解最高可以达到()oA. 2NFB. 3NFC、4NFD、BCNF28、在关系模式的分解中满足无损欠连接最高对以达到(A、2NFB. 3NFC. BCNFD、4NF29、

8、在关系模式的分解中,既保持因数依赖乂满足无损火连接最高町以达到(A. 2NFB. 3NFC、4NFD、BCNF30、在关系模式R(UT丿中,F是最小函数依赖集,则R的规范化程度达到()A. 2NFB. 3NFC. BCNFD、不一定二、填空题1. 与1NF相比,2NF消除了非主属性对码的.2. 与2NF相比,3NF消除了非主属性对码的.3. 与3NF相比,BCNF消除了.4. 如果RGBCNF.则R的主属性对J:不包介它的码满足5. 耍求模式分解満足保持函数依赖",一泄能达到的范式是6. 惭数依赖是多值依赖的,多值依赖是两数依赖的7. 关系规范化的口的是控制数据兀余.避免异常和异常8

9、. 在对关系模式进行分解时,需满足才能不丢失数据信息。9. 关系模式RW3NF,每个候选码都仅是单属性,则R泄属J:o10、在关系模式 R (U, F)屮,U=ABCDE, F= AE-UBC-DAD-E。R 的码是R属于:NFo三、应用题1、已知:关系模式R(U)U=ABCDEGF= A-B,C-G,Ef A,CE-D求:(1) R的候选码。(2) R最高属于哪级范式。2、已知:关系模式R (UT)U=CTSNGF= CTCS-G'S-N求:(1) R的候选码。(2) R垠高属F哪级范式。3、已知:关系模式R (UT)U=ABCDEF= A-BCCD-E.E-N、Ef D求:(1)

10、R的候选码。(2) R最高属哪级范式4、已知:关系模式R (UJF)U=ABCDF= A-C,Cf A,E-AC,D AC求:(1) F的最小函数依赖集。(2) R的候选码。(3) R最高属于哪级范式(4) 将模式R无损失连接分解为BCNF(5) 将模式R无损失连接H.保持两数依赖分解为3NF5、已知:关系模式R (UJ5)中U=ABCDF= AC、Cf A、Ef AC.EDf A写出F的一切最小换数依赖集。6、已知:关系模式R (UJF)中U=ABCDEF- A-D;Ef D,DB,BCD,CD-A求:(1) F的最小函数依赖集。(2) R的候选码。(3) 将R分解为3NFo7、已知:关系模

11、式R (UT)中U-ABCDEGF= BG-UBD-E、DG-CADG-BC, AG-B, B-D求:(1) F的绘小函数依赖集。(2) R的候选码。(3) R最高属f哪级范式(4) 将模式R按观范化耍求分解。8、已知:关系模式R (UT)屮R-ABCDEGF= BEfGBDfG,CDEAB,CD A,CE-G,ECf AR-D,C-D求:(1)F的最小怖数依赖集。(2)R的候选码。(3)R最高属哪级范式(4)将模式R按规范化要求分解。9、已知:关系模式R (UT)中R=ABCDEGF= EE-G,BDf G, CD-ACE-G, CDE-AB, BC-A.BD求:(1)F的最小函数依赖集。(

12、2)R的候选码。(3)最高属于哪级范式(4)将模式R按规范化耍求分解。10、已知:关系模式R (UT)中R=ABCDEGF= AE-UEC-D, EE-C,CD-氏 CE-AG,CG-ED,CA,D-EG求:(1)F的最小函数依赖集。(2)R的候选码。(3)R最高属哪级范式(4)将模式R按规范化耍求分解。综合练习四参考答案15.B28.D一单项选择题1. B 2. C 3. D 4. C 5. B 6. B 7.C 8.A 9.D 10.D 11.A 12.A 13. C 14.C16. B 17.B 18. C 19.C 20.D 21.B 22.A 23.A 24.D 25.D 26.C

13、27.B 29. B 30.D二、填空题1. 部分苗数依赖2. 传递曲数依赖3. 冗余的码4. 完全函数依赖5. 3NF6. 特例推广7. 插入删除(与次序无关)8. 无损失连接9. BCNF10. AB2三、应用题1. (1) CE (2) INF 2(1) CS (2) INF3. (1)候选码:A,BC,CD疋 (2)3NF4. (1)最小换数依赖集:Fmin= AC,C*A,B"AQA(2)候选码:BD (3) INF(4)将模式R无损失连接分解为BCNFP= AC,BA,DA.BD)(5)将模式R无损失连接H保持换数依赖分解为3NF。P= AC,BA,DA.BD)5. 有4

14、个等价的最小函数依赖集:Fl= AY,Cf AJBYQYF2= AC,C A、Bf C,DAF4= A-*C,C-*A,B-*A,D-* C 6. (1) F的最小旳数依赖集是:Fmui= A-*DJE-*D,D-*B,BC-*D,CD-*A(2) R的候选码是:CE(3) 将 R 分解为 3NF: P= AD,DE,BD,BCDACD7. (1) F的最小函数依赖集是:Fmin= E*D,DGCAGB,(2) R的候选码是:AG (3) 2NF(4) 将 R 分解为 3NF: P= BDE,CDGABG8. (1) F的最小函数依赖集是:Fmin= B-G,CE-B,C-A,CE-G,Bf D,C-D(2) R的候选码是:CE (3) INF(4)将 R 分解为 3NF: P= BDG, BCEGACD 9. (1) F的最小函数依赖集是:Fmi

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论